Frequently Asked Questions

What is the Repit School Score for Charles N Scott Middle School?
Charles N Scott Middle School has a Repit School Score of 76 out of 100, earning a grade of B. This score evaluates class size (student-teacher ratio), funding levels, and resources rather than just test scores.
How many students attend Charles N Scott Middle School?
Charles N Scott Middle School has 734 students enrolled for the 2024-25 school year. The student-to-teacher ratio is 18.4:1.
What grades does Charles N Scott Middle School serve?
Charles N Scott Middle School serves grades 07 – 08 and is classified as a Middle. This is a public school.
How much funding does Charles N Scott Middle School receive per student?
Charles N Scott Middle School receives $16,325 in per-pupil spending from its district. This is above the national average.
